As the Product Owner for Vulnerability Management & Effectiveness, you will oversee our IT vulnerability management program, ensuring effective identification, assessment, and tracking of vulnerabilities. In this strategic advisory role, you will define processes, set up scans, create incidents based on findings, and coordinate remediation efforts with responsible teams. Additionally, you will plan penetration testing and red teaming activities while maintaining the vulnerability management solution. Your focus will be on process management and stakeholder coordination rather than hands-on technical implementation.

Your Contribution:

  • Define and implement processes, handbooks, and workflows for vulnerability management
  • Maintain the vulnerability management solution, including technical updates such as updating local scanners
  • Lead and manage external service providers to ensure effective and proactive vulnerability management
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to set up scans, including firewall exclusions and tool configurations
  • Create incidents based on scan findings, assign them to responsible teams, and follow up to ensure timely resolution
  • Provide recommendations for fixing solutions based on tool outputs without direct implementation responsibility
  • Plan, scope, and align penetration testing and red teaming activities with internal and external stakeholders
  • Work closely with internal teams and external providers to ensure effective vulnerability management and testing coordination
  • Ensure vulnerability management processes align with regulatory and organizational compliance requirements
